Pack to the Future Conference
The ‘Cost’ of Sustainability – Who Pays?
Loughborough University, Wednesday 24 July 2024

The conference focuses on the theme ‘cost' of sustainability from commercial, economic, design, environmental and behavioural perspectives.

Doors open at 8.45am with light refreshments.
The conference will start at 9.30am

Presentations from:
• Mark Shayler, Keynote Address. You Can't Make Money from a Dead Planet: The sustainable method for driving profits. Working with clients including Nike, Coca Cola, Samsung and John Lewis, Mark helps big companies think small and small companies think big. Making stuff better and making better stuff.
• Harshal Gore, Head of Strategy & External Relations pEPR, DEFRA. Latest developments from DEFRA on sustainable packaging. Harshal is a Senior Executive driving impact through digital and industry collaboration strategies with the vision to put societal and environmental needs at the forefront of industry ambition.
• Lucy Eggleston, Senior Consultant, Eunomia. The Price is Tight: balancing cost and sustainability in packaging closed loop recycling. With a material science and engineering background, her expertise is in extended producer responsibility, design for recycling, and sustainable packaging solutions.
• Gary Tee, Tipa Compostables. The value of compostable packaging and the benefits that it brings as a mainstream solution. Gary has been involved in the -flexible packaging industry for over 30 years. Driven by sustainability, he takes pride in helping retailers, brands, and converters make the switch to compostable ¬flexible packaging.
• James Pryor, Touch Design. Designing with climate in mind. Realising business transformation and game-changing innovation through physical packaging and product design.
• Aaron Tucker – Michigan State Univ, USA. Looking toward the future! He will explore the latest research and trends shaping the future of packaging conducted by faculty in the School of Packaging at MSU.
• Nikki Clark, Loughborough Univ. Mapping the value of Sustainable Design for reusable packaging. Exploring the four different perspectives of value (economic, psychological, sociological and ecological) and their impact when developing a reusable packaging service.

The conference closes at 4.30pm.

Lunch and refreshments will be provided throughout the day.
